Solution Overview
Problem
Online content management systems lack effective mechanisms for administrators to control and limit the sharing of content outside of a group, potentially leading to the inadvertent sharing of sensitive data with unauthorized users.
Innovation Solution
Implementing methods and systems that allow administrators to manage access to shared content by determining approved requestors, controlling types of shared links, and setting permissions for group members, including options for always public, always private, or user-specified privacy settings, to restrict sharing outside the group.

Data Source
AI summary
Systems and methods for controlling access to shared content in an online content management system, include receiving a request to access a content item from a requester, wherein the content item is stored in a synchronized online content management system. The example method then includes determining that the requester is in an approved list of requestors and granting access to the content item. In one variation, the request to access the content item includes activation of a shared link. In another variation, the request to access the content item includes access to a shared folder in the synchronized online content management system. In a third variation, determining that the requester is in an approved list of requesters includes determining that the requester is logged into a primary and secondary account, and that the requester is in an approved list for the secondary account.
